What Is a Car Key Auto Locksmith?

Modern automobiles do not have traditional keys made of metal and require specialized technology in order to start the vehicle. In these situations the most reliable person to contact is locksmith.

Tools

Auto locksmiths that specialize in car keys have a large selection of tools that can handle various situations. They can utilize these tools to cut new keys and program smart keys or even fix the ignition if it has been damaged. They also have a selection of lockout tools that allow them to gain access to vehicles without damaging the lock. They can then get their customers back in the car quickly and efficiently.

The most crucial tools for a car key auto locksmith include an automotive lockout kit, a set slim jims, and an electronic cloning device. The kit for unlocking the car includes tools to create a gap between the frame and the door, which is then used to wedge open the lock. It also includes an oil to aid in the process of picking the lock. A slim jim is a small piece of spring steel that has the correct shapes cut into it to hold the locking mechanism in a vehicle.

An electronic cloning device is able to duplicate a transponder key, that can then be programmed to specific vehicles. This is especially helpful in the event that you've lost your keys or have them stolen. These devices can cost anywhere from $2,000 to $3000, however they're extremely durable and easy to use. They are available at a variety of hardware stores as well as on the internet.

Modern car keys are encoded with computer chips, compared to old-fashioned locks which have a code engraved on them. This means that they must be programmed to work with the vehicle of the owner that requires specialized equipment and software. To accomplish this, a locksmith needs to first learn the appropriate programming protocols for a particular car model. These specialty tools are made by various companies which include Advanced Diagnostics. They offer their products under a variety of names, such as T-Code Pro, Codeseeker, and MVP-Pro.

The technician must test the key after it has been programmed to ensure it is working. If it doesn't, they'll have to repeat the process. This could be a long and costly process, which is why it's important for an automotive locksmith to have the right tools for the job.

Rates

The cost charged by car key auto locksmiths varies widely depending on the type of service. Basic services, such as unlocking a car, cost between $50 and 100 however, other services are more expensive. Changing the locks on a car door, for instance could cost as much as $100. The majority of locksmiths charge by the hour, so a longer job will cost more.

Knowing how locksmiths set their rates is important for choosing a trustworthy and reasonable one. Some scammers take advantage of people who are in need by imposing a high price or using bait and switching tactics.
